加速LINQ到SQL查询

本文关键字:查询 SQL LINQ 加速 | 更新日期: 2023-09-27 17:58:49

在编写LINQ to SQL查询以优化或加速LINQ to SQL时,我们可以记住哪些常见事项?。

例如,通常,每次执行查询时,LINQ to SQL都必须将LINQ查询转换为SQL;这涉及到在几个阶段递归构成查询的表达式树。我们所做的类似于使用CompiledQuery类预编译查询。

加速LINQ到SQL查询

关于LINQ,每个开发人员都应该知道一件有用的事情。这是关于"加入"与"在哪里"的表现。

完整的讨论可以在这里看到,为什么加入比

更快

通常,本机LINQ2SQL编译器会让您忘记整个优化查询的麻烦,但也有一些关于编译查询滥用的注意事项。以下是您应该查看的一些资源。:)

http://visualstudiomagazine.com/articles/2010/06/24/five-tips-linq-to-sql.aspxhttp://weblogs.asp.net/dixin/archive/2011/01/31/understanding-linq-to-sql-11-performance.aspx